<p>A gyroscopic compass has a single neutrally suspended gyro rotor held in the horizontal plane by a torque generated by displacing a mass on the gyro rotor support in the direction of the rotor axis. It eliminates the problem of unknown long-term deflections in azimuth caused by unknown centre of gravity displacement associated with oil displacement mass arrangements and the extreme balancing requirements for different degrees of freedom. The rotor support, which carries the rotor bearing is mounted in a floating sphere so as to rotate about a gimbal axis. The gimbal axis intersects the rotor axis at the centre point of the rotor support and the parts resting on it. These parts include the displacement mass, its corresp. motor and a motor control accelerometer measuring along the rotor axis.</p> |
